Official information
The Maidstone and the Iguanodon exhibit focuses on the historical significance of the Iguanodon dinosaur, discovered in the early 19th century. Visitors can learn about the fossil's discovery, its characteristics, and its impact on the field of palaeontology, as well as view related artifacts from Maidstone Museum's collection.
